Volumio Information
Volumio Version: 2.873-2021-02-19
Hardware: Raspberry Pi Zero W
DAC: XMOS xCORE USB Audio 2.0
I am trying to stream some high-res audio files (FLAC 192 kHz 24 bit, DSD64/128) through a Raspberry Pi Zero W with an XMOS USB DAC, using BubbleUPnP + upmpdcli. The problem is that I can hear various pops/clicks in every audio file, and with DSD the audio stutters a lot especially at the start of the song. If the files are read from a USB drive connected to the Raspberry (so no streaming involved) the situation is better, but some clicks are still there. I have tried to change the “buffer size” and the “buffer before play” settings, without success. Searching through the forum, I found that there are various posts where it is explained that the Raspberry Pi Zero W (and the Raspberry Pi 3) has some problems managing the USB communication; is it true? Is there a way to improve the reproduction? Using an I2S DAC could potentially solve the problems?
